El Camino Real de los Tejas National Historic Trail Act - Amends the National Trails System Act to designate El Camino Real de los Tejas (the Trail) as a National Historic Trail. Authorizes the establishment of the Trail on portions of the National Historic Trail on: (1) publicly-owned lands; and (2) privately-owned lands only with the consent of the landowner. Requires the Secretary of the Interior to administer the Trail and to consult with State and local agencies in the planning and development of the Trail. Authorizes the Secretary to coordinate activities relating to the Trail with U.S. and Mexican public and non-governmental organizations and other entities. Prohibits the acquisition of lands for the Trail outside the federally-administered area without the consent of the landowner.
